  • stating that Section 81 is not intended to address a prisoner’s complaint of neglect in treatment and medication
  • stating that Section 81 is not intended to address a prisoner's complaint of neglect in treatment and medication
  • concluding peti tioner not eligible for relief under section 81 where “sole complaint [was] neglect in treatment and medication, which [was] capable of being remedied without transfer”
  • affirming trial court’s denial of Tuddles’ petition to reduce his sentence to house arrest pursuant to 61 P.S. § 81 (since repealed and replaced by 42 Pa.C.S. § 9777 [6])
  • addressing a prior statute that was rescinded concurrently with the enactment of § 9777
